Output 28dde413dc9fc4ec77b2cb07b6cc740fd9ea6abbcd59bd5670a97009e8fc3c88:0

value
71573
script pubkey
OP_0 OP_PUSHBYTES_20 9ab3e70186130cb3a8daf26f61208498f9f7036f
address
bc1qn2e7wqvxzvxt82x67fhkzgyynrulwqm0m520t2
transaction
28dde413dc9fc4ec77b2cb07b6cc740fd9ea6abbcd59bd5670a97009e8fc3c88
confirmations
170016
spent
true